Limited View for Share with Proton users calendar sharing
When using the "Share with Proton users" aspect of shared calendars you cannot choose limited view, only full details or edit permissions. Currently Limited view is only available if you use the Share with anyone and create a link. This seems like an easy change, I want to be able to share my calendar without a link (that could be leaked), but also not have to burden the one person I wish to share it with with the curse of knowledge (the minutiae of my every movement.)

Filters should label mails both sent or received from same address
In a case to Proton support I asked why emails was not labeled accordingly, when the filter was defined as both recipient and sender. The supporter's answer was that I had to create two filters, one for sender address and one for recipient. This works, but I want to request an enhancement to be able to create a single filter with an OR statement, either recipient OR sender, with the same address.

Sieve filters can create duplicates which can cause confusion; allow way to remove from filtered folder
Sieve filters can create duplicates even if you don't run them against the Sent folder because it appears it runs on outgoing messages. It took me a minute to figure out how to stop this, but in the interim duplicates were created, meaning I had the message in the Sent folder, but I also had it in a filtered folder.
So, I went about to delete the message from the filtered folder and confirmed that the original message remained in the Sent folder. All appeared to be good.
